JetBrains-Software automatisch als Root starten (über Plank-Shortcuts) unter Ubuntu 16.04

JetBrains-Software automatisch als Root starten (über Plank-Shortcuts) unter Ubuntu 16.04

Ich bin ganz neu in der Linux-Umgebung, ich komme von Windows.

Ich habe Ubuntu 16.04 auf meinem Rechner (einem XPS 15 9550 mit Dual-Boot – Win10), ein Plank und ein Theme (Macbuntu, gib mir nicht die Schuld :p) installiert.

Ich bin es gewohnt, mit WebStorm und PhpStorm zu programmieren, also habe ich beide installiert und eine Verknüpfung erstellt mitExtras -> Desktopeintrag erstellen ...über die Software.

Jetzt befinden sich meine Verknüpfungen im Plank und ich möchte diese Anwendungen automatisch als Root starten.

Ich habe versucht zu bearbeiten/usr/share/applications/jetbrains-xxxx.desktopum den Befehl wie folgt zu ändern Exec:

Exec: gksudo -k -u root <DEFAULT_COMMAND>

Aber es scheint nicht zu funktionieren. Die Software fragt mich nie nach einem Passwort und ich kann meine Dateien nicht bearbeiten, weil mir die Berechtigung für den Ordner, an dem ich arbeite, verweigert wurde (glaube ich).

Ich möchte Dateien bearbeiten in/var/www/html/*(neue LAMP-Installation). Diese Ordner gehören zu root:plugdev. Ich habe versucht, dies in zu ändern www-data:www-dataund meinen Benutzer zu dieser Gruppe hinzuzufügen, aber es schlägt fehl. Mein Benutzer gehört auch zu plugdev.

Ich weiß nicht, was ich tun soll:

  • Versuchen Sie, die UGO-Rechte auf 775 zu ändern (aktuell sind es 755).
  • Suche weiterhin nach einer Möglichkeit, meine Software als Root zu starten. Mir gefällt diese Idee, weil ich das nur einmal machen kann und es dann für immer funktioniert.

Vielen Dank für Ihre Hilfe :).

Antwort1

Die IDEs von Jetbrains verfügen über ein Bereitstellungsmodul, das die Berechtigungsänderungen für Sie übernimmt, sodass Sie die Sicherheit nicht schwächen müssen. Es gibt eine spezielle Option für „In-Place-Server“, die Ihr Szenario handhabt.

https://www.jetbrains.com/help/phpstorm/2016.1/deployment.html

verwandte Informationen